Colts punter Pat McAfee has a simple request for Antonio Brown this week: Don't kick him in the face while his mom is watching. Please.

The Colts and Steelers will face off in a Thanksgiving Day matchup on Thursday, and McAfee is hoping Brown — the Steelers wide receiver — won't repeat what he did to one unlucky punter two years ago.

Brown tried to jump over Cleveland punter Spencer Lanning in 2014, but kicked him straight in the face instead.

Brown, who twerked his way into NFL headlines this season, had some fun with McAfee.

Brown leads the NFL with 77 receptions, and the Colts will be without star quarterback Andrew Luck, who is still nursing a concussion, so the Colts may have bigger problems than getting kicked in the face.

Still, a face-full of cleats isn't exactly something to be thankful for.
